Whenever I click on the What's Related Tab in the sidebar,
The Browser window will become de-maximise. The window stays
the same size but moves away (in a cascade-like way).The browser
window was originally maximise. Problem does not occur with
other tabs
Reproducible: Always
Steps to Reproduce:
1.Maximise browser
2.Click on What's Related in Sidebar
3.Problem occurs
Actual Results: Browser window de-maximise
Expected Results: Keep the Window maximised
